Commanding Block Liquidity for Bitcoin and Ethereum Options

Transacting large blocks of Bitcoin or Ethereum options through a specialized request for quotation system provides a decisive edge. This approach enables a trader to solicit bids and offers from multiple liquidity providers simultaneously, all within a private environment. The competitive dynamic among these dealers drives tighter spreads and more favorable pricing, directly translating into enhanced capital efficiency.

Such systems facilitate the execution of significant positions without the adverse price impact associated with public order books. These private channels represent a critical component of professional trading infrastructure.

Executing Options Spreads with Reduced Slippage

Options spreads, a cornerstone of sophisticated derivatives strategies, demand meticulous execution to preserve their intended risk-reward profiles. A request for quotation environment enables traders to solicit pricing for complex spread structures, ensuring the entire spread is quoted and filled as a single transaction. This methodology effectively mitigates the risk of slippage across individual legs, a common challenge in fragmented public markets. The resultant execution fidelity preserves the strategic intent of the trade, a crucial factor for consistent profitability.

A crucial insight involves understanding that market impact is a form of information leakage. Every public order reveals intent, allowing other participants to front-run or adjust their own positions. The private, multi-dealer interaction inherent in advanced execution models effectively seals this leakage, preserving the informational advantage of the initiating trader.

Request for Quotation

Meaning ▴ A Request for Quotation (RFQ) is a structured protocol enabling an institutional principal to solicit executable price commitments from multiple liquidity providers for a specific digital asset derivative instrument, defining the quantity and desired execution parameters.

Price Impact

Meaning ▴ Price Impact refers to the measurable change in an asset's market price directly attributable to the execution of a trade order, particularly when the order size is significant relative to available market liquidity.

Crypto Options

Meaning ▴ Crypto Options are derivative financial instruments granting the holder the right, but not the obligation, to buy or sell a specified underlying digital asset at a predetermined strike price on or before a particular expiration date.

Market Microstructure

Meaning ▴ Market Microstructure refers to the study of the processes and rules by which securities are traded, focusing on the specific mechanisms of price discovery, order flow dynamics, and transaction costs within a trading venue.
